Mixing story-driven exploration, social areas, and PvE and PvP zones of assorted difficulties, Pioner takes place on a sprawling, 50km² island within the aftermath of an enormous catastrophe. Previously a Soviet territory that is now dilapidated and stricken by anomalies, Stalker enjoyers will completely really feel at house right here. A faction-based development system permits you to develop your fame with the island’s varied key figures, and the extra you facet with them, the higher the gadgets you’ll purchase from related distributors. Oh, and even in these post-apocalyptic wastelands, there’s nonetheless time for fishing. It is an MMO important, at this level.
Your survival expertise shall be examined simply as a lot as your purpose when embarking on actions. You need to handle your starvation and relaxation ranges to make sure your power stays as excessive as potential, and also you higher ensure you’ve received sufficient sources packed for no matter quest you are embarking on – make good use of crafting benches to assemble what you want earlier than heading out.
All of it seems and sounds proper up my avenue, and regardless that that is an early entry launch, Pioner’s drummed up a good quantity of help for an impartial MMO – on the time of writing, its participant rely sits at over 1,200 gamers and it is nonetheless climbing.
Nevertheless, as with so many early entry releases, there seems to be an extended checklist of points to type out. Whereas a hotfix has already gone stay at present, Wednesday December 17, to enhance main ache factors like load occasions, facial animation bugs, and server stability, these points have led to numerous destructive evaluations which might be diluting the optimistic ones. In reality, gamers are fairly break up down the center in these early hours of Pioner’s life, with the sport sitting on a ‘blended’ person rating of fifty%, based mostly on over 400 evaluations.
Work to be finished, then, however I nonetheless suppose the premise of Pioner will carry it via. Plus, GFA goes to waste little time progressing the sport’s sci-fi-inspired narrative, with the primary drop of latest story content material arriving “as early as January 2026.” The developer additionally says {that a} roadmap of its future plans shall be launched very quickly.
